Because for riders who at most races will finish outside of top 20 in MXGP there is more budget to be found doing national races then go to GPs.
Roan van de Moosdijk (who actually was top 10 this year at sardegna) explained that pretty decent in a gatedrop interview last week: He can make money at the German championship which is better then having no salary at MXGP.
In MX2 its due to EMX250. Yes they did not race this weekend, so in theory free to ride MX2, but they allready do 14 races so its not in the budget for most to do an extra mx2 race in France.
